This week's progress on our artist copy project included me practicing more with the quill as well as starting the actual drawing. I began the project be creating an enlarged grid of the original picture onto a bigger piece of paper and separating it into squares. I then drew a general outline of the figure with pencil so as to get the proportions right before I used more permanent materials. After that I began to draw using Rembrandt's mark which proved to be harder than expected. Rembrandt's actual drawing was a sketch, mostly likely done on a small piece of paper, and it was difficult to replicate that with as big of a piece of paper I am using. I also found it strange to have to reload the quill with ink so often, after using normal pen for so long.
